11.2.2 UART0 Transmit/Receive Buffer (UA0BUF)
Address: 0F290H
Access: R/W
Access size: 8-bit
Initial value: 00H

UA0BUF is a special function register (SFR) to store the transmitted/received data of the UART.
In transmit mode, write transmission data to UA0BUF. To transmit the data consecutively, confirm the U0FUL flag of the
UART0 status register (UA0STAT) becomes "0", then write the next transmitted data to the UA0BUF. Any value written
to UA0BUF can be read.
In receive mode, since data received at termination of reception is stored in UA0BUF, read the contents of UABUF using
the UART0 interrupt at termination of reception. At continuous reception, BA0BUF is updated whenever reception
terminates. Any write to BA0BUF is disabled in receive mode.
The bits, which are not required when any of the 5- to 8-bit data length is selected, become invalid in transmit mode and
are set to “0” in receive mode.
Note:
For operation in transmit mode, be sure to set the transmit mode (UA0MOD0 and UA0MOD1) before setting the
transmitted data in UAOBUF.
